March News ended with Luisa Fallon’s “Boss” qualifying for his Agility Warrant Gold and becoming Newlin Rambler AW(G).

April News begins with more news of Boss as his success in agility continues. The clever boy won out of G5 by winning his agility class at Kingdom of Fife Agility KC show on 6th April so now moves up to G6.

The HOUND ASSOCIATION OF SCOTLAND held their CHAMPIONSHIP show at Errol, Perthshire on 14th April. Beagles were judged by Liz Calikes.

Main awards were:

 Dog Challenge Certificate                       Molesend Giorgio (Mr M W & Mrs J S Goldberg)

 Reserve Dog Challenge Certificate       Bellvalley Epsom Gold (Mr G.L. & Mrs L.J Evans)

 Bitch Challenge Certificate                     Ch Annavah Princess Tiana (Miss L.A. & Mrs P.J. Havard)

 Reserve Bitch Challenge Certificate     Ch Felinoak Ffansy Nansi JW (Mrs C Tanner)

 Best Of Breed & BIS3                               Ch Annavah Princess Tiana

 Best Puppy & BPIS3                                 Bellvalley Epsom Gold

 Best Veteran                                             Davricard Belladonna for Rosamax (Mrs H & Prof S Eldabe)

 Best Junior                                                 Kingswin Jules In The Crown (Ms D & Mr H Bridgeman & Logue)

 Best Special Beginner                             Kelcardi Claudia (Miss W Kilgour)

 

At the recent AGM chairperson Liz Calikes presented the annual trophies to winning owner Hazel Deans. The Scottish Beagle of the Year Challenge Trophy and the Craigmount Trophy were won by Ch Gempeni Cornflower ShCEx. This is the third year running that Maisie, pictured left, has won the trophies. WELKS CHAMPIONSHIP SHOW was held at Malvern from 25th - 28th April. Beagles were judged on Friday 26th where Serena Parker & Graham Stevens’ Ch Serenaker Armani notched up another DCC. The STAR of the day was Pam and Lynda Havard’s Ch Annavah Princess Tiana who took BCC and BOB before going on to win HG1. She then returned on Sunday to win BEST IN SHOW.

Judges were Mr John Thirlwell (Beagles), Mr Bill Browne-Cole (Hound Group) and Mr John Ritchie (Best in Show).

May

DEVON, CORNWALL & SOUTH WEST BEAGLE SOCIETY CHAMPIONSHIP SHOW was held on 5th May and  judged by Andrea Keepence-Keyte. Pam and Lynda Havard’s Ch Annavah Princess Tiana was awarded her 35th CC before going on to win BEST IN SHOW.

BIRMINGHAM NATIONAL CHAMPIONSHIP SHOW was held on 12th May at Staffordshire County Showground. Judge Tim Jones awarded the DCC to Serena Parker & Graham StevensCh Serenaker Armani and  the BCC and BOB to Pam and Lynda Havard’s Ch Annavah Princess Tiana. The same owners also won the RDCC and BPIB with Annavah Justify. Tiana went on to win HG3 judged by Mr Stuart Milner and Justify won HPG1 judged by Mr Stuart Byrne. Armani had further success, winning the Eukanuba Champion Stakes overall judged by Mr K Robin Newhouse.
